Shipping container construction describes the practice of using steel Shipping Container Sizes containers as structural elements for structures and other structures. Initially developed for carrying items across seas, these containers are repurposed into homes, workplaces, pop-up shops, and even schools. By converting these resilient metal boxes into habitable areas, contractors highlight sustainability and resourcefulness.

Cost-Effectiveness: One of the primary benefits of shipping container construction is cost savings. Containers are usually readily available at a fraction of the price of conventional building materials. This cost opens avenues for ingenious structure jobs, particularly in locations with restricted spending plans.
Sustainability: By repurposing existing products, the construction of shipping container homes reduces waste and motivates sustainable living. It is a practical way of making use of a resource that may otherwise contribute to landfill overflow.
Speed of Construction: Shipping container structures can often be assembled rapidly. Considering that containers show up pre-fabricated to a degree, the time required for on-site construction can be substantially lowered.
Resilience and Security: Shipping containers are constructed to hold up against harsh conditions throughout transportation. They are made from corten steel, which is weather-resistant and offers significant durability. This makes them secure for Dry Storage Containers and living.
Movement: Shipping container homes can be moved with relative ease. This flexibility suits those who might want to change their surroundings or move their home for numerous reasons.

While there are numerous advantages, prospective builders must likewise consider a number of obstacles connected with shipping container construction.
Building Regulations and Regulations: Not all locations allow the construction of shipping container homes. It's necessary to examine local zoning laws and building codes to prevent possible legal issues.
Insulation Issues: Shipping containers can maintain heat in summertime and can be too cold in winter season. Correct insulation solutions are necessary to develop a comfy living environment.
Limited Space: Containers typically have actually repaired dimensions, which may restrict design choices and space. Careful planning is important for accommodating the needs of the occupants.
Design Complexity: While containers use versatility, creating a functional design can be challenging. Designers and home builders need to believe artistically to make the most of the offered space.
Corrosion and Maintenance: The metal used in containers can rust if not treated correctly. Regular maintenance is required to make sure the structural integrity of the container.

1. How much does it cost to build a shipping container home?
Costs can vary commonly depending upon the design, place, and products used. Usually, a standard Buy Shipping Containers container home may cost between ₤ 10,000 to ₤ 50,000, omitting land expenses.
2. Are shipping container homes safe?
Yes, shipping container homes can be safe and secure when effectively built and designed. It's vital to deal with skilled builders who understand the required modifications.
3. How long do shipping container homes last?
With proper upkeep, shipping container homes can last for decades, often outlasting standard wood-framed homes.
4. Can I get financing for a shipping container home?
Yes, some loan providers use funding particularly for alternative construction methods like shipping container homes. It's a good idea to consult with home mortgage specialists.
5. Are shipping container homes energy-efficient?
Shipping container homes can be created to be energy-efficient with appropriate insulation, photovoltaic panels, and energy-saving appliances.
